Understanding Spanish 21


Spanish 21 is arguably the most famous and widely played blackjack variation in both physical and digital casinos.


In Spanish 21, a player's blackjack always beats a dealer's blackjack, and you can double down on absolutely any number of cards.


  • All standard '10' cards are removed, leaving 48-card decks
  • A player's total of 21 always wins, regardless of the dealer's hand
  • Players can "rescue" or surrender their hand after doubling down

How to Play Blackjack Switch


The magic happens when the player is allowed to freely switch the second card dealt to each of the two hands.


If you are dealt a 10-5 and a 6-10, you can switch them to create a perfect 10-10 (20) and a 6-5 (11).
